Posted By: Kevin Cummings

While there may have been a Baltimore Terrpin team in 1913, it was not part of the Federal League (which was an independent minor league at that point).

The 1913 Federal League teams were Indianapolis, Covington (Kentucky), Pittsburgh, Cleveland, St. Louis, and Chicago. Cleveland folded at the end of the season and Baltimore replaced them for 1914.

Posted By: Jim Rivera

BALTIMORE TERRAPINS
Franchise Facts
Established 1914
Disbanded 1915
Located Baltimore

Owners Carrol W. Rasin
Ned Hanlon
John S. Wilson Jr.
Harry Goldman

President Carrol W. Rasin

Year by Year Results
W L %
1914 84 70 .545
1915 47 107 .305

1914 standings
Indaplis IND 88 65 .575 --
Chicago CHI 87 67 .565 1.5
Bltmore BAL 84 70 .545 4.5
Buffalo BUF 80 71 .530 7.0
Brooklyn BTT 77 77 .500 11.5
KansasCy KCP 67 84 .444 20.0
Pittsbgh PBS 64 86 .427 22.5
St.Louis SLM 62 89 .411 25.0

1915 standings
St.Louis SLM 87 67 .565 --
Chicago CHI 86 66 .566 --
Pittsbgh PBS 86 67 .562 0.5
KansasCy KCP 81 72 .529 5.5
Newark NEW 80 72 .526 6.0
Buffalo BUF 74 78 .487 12.0
Brooklyn BTT 70 82 .461 16.0
Bltmore BAL 47 107 .305 40.0
